Who are we?

Glendale, a winner of BALI Employer of the Year, has revenues of £45 million. Winner of the 2025 Supreme Award and 2025 Pro Landscaper Business Award Grounds Maintenance Company of the Year.

Glendale is one of the largest green space management service providers in the UK and specialises in tree care and management, grounds maintenance and landscaping. For more information visit www.glendale-services.co.uk. We are a green business with “green thinking” at the core of everything we do. We have been at the forefront of green services provision since 1989 and offer innovative solutions for the management and maintenance of the green environment.

A Glimpse into the Role awaiting You

  • Assisting the Supervisor and Senior Team Leaders in the effective delivery of the programmed maintenance.

  • Taking responsibility for the works on site, including timekeeping, productivity arrangements for breaks, dealing with members of the public, visitors to the site and deliveries.

  • Proactively leading by example, motivating and guiding the team and maintaining workforce discipline.

  • Operating and ensuring others operate company and hire vehicles, machinery and equipment with care and that daily checks and routine servicing are carried and properly recorded.

  • To undertake other duties as may be reasonably required by the Supervisor
